4-BroMo-5-iodo-2-Methyl-benzoic acid

Description:
4-Bromo-5-iodo-2-methylbenzoic acid is an aromatic carboxylic acid characterized by the presence of a benzoic acid core substituted with bromine and iodine atoms, as well as a methyl group. The bromine atom is located at the para position (4-position) and the iodine at the meta position (5-position) relative to the carboxylic acid group, while the methyl group is positioned at the ortho position (2-position). This compound is typically a solid at room temperature and may exhibit moderate solubility in organic solvents. Its molecular structure contributes to its potential reactivity, making it useful in various chemical syntheses, particularly in the development of p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als. The presence of halogens can influence the compound's electronic properties, affecting its reactivity and interactions with other molecules. Additionally, the carboxylic acid functional group can participate in hydrogen bonding, which may impact its physical properties and solubility in polar solvents. Overall, 4-bromo-5-iodo-2-methylbenzoic acid is a versatile compound with applications in organic synthesis and medicinal chemistry.
Formula:C8H6BrIO2
